Catla (LABEO catla), also KNOWN as the major South Asian carp, is an economically important South Asian freshwater fish in the carp family Cyprinidae. It is native to rivers and lakes in northern India, Bangladesh, Myanmar, Nepal, and PAKISTAN, but has also been introduced elsewhere in South ASIA and is commonly FARMED.[1][2]
